Figure 8.31 demonstrates the use of CSS to configure a table head, table body, and table footer with different styles. This attribute specifies a title of the table that can be accessed by a screen reader. The value of the title attribute is displayed by some browsers, such as Internet Explorer 5 , when the mouse passes over the table area. The WAI prefers using the summary attribute or the caption element instead of the title attribute. XHTML Table Captions The element is often used with a data table to describe its contents.

The lowest priority are styles specified by the browser. Style rules are applied in cascading order based on priority. Color and Visual Contrast In Chapter 2, you learned about the principles of color as a design tool and that a well-chosen color scheme creates unity among pages at a website.

As you read about each element attribute, experiment with the Birthday List table. The best way to learn to write XHTML is to practice it. Inline styles configure this paragraph to have red text and take precedence over the embedded and external styles.

As you read this chapter and try the examples, concentrate on learning the features and capabilities of each technology, rather than trying to master the details. The Web server log contains useful information about your visitors, how they find your site, and what pages they visit. Check to see if the log is available to you. Some Web hosts provide reports about the log. See Chapter 13 for more information on Web server logs. A Web host that offers an SLA with an uptime guarantee shows that they value service and reliability.

Social media, or uploading directly to your blog or website. Examine the results of your research. Include a recommendation, based on your research, for purchasing or downloading a video-editing software program or app.

  • By encouraging customers to reply or comment to blog posts or share with others, a company can help build a community of customers.
  • Copy the pashapodcast.mp3 sound file from the student files in the Chapter11/CaseStudyStarters folder and save it to your paintercss folder.
  • Document Object Model, CSS, Web browser d.
  • Silverlight is a crossbrowser and cross-platform RIA plug-in, which means that you can use it with many popular browsers.

Building on this textbook’s successful first edition, the second edition of Basics of Web Design & CSS3 features a focus on HTML5 instead of introducing both XHTML and HTML5 syntax together. This singular focus is beneficial to individuals new to web design. The 10th edition of Web Development & Design Foundations is available in both print and Pearson eText formats. I began writing my first web development textbook, Web Development & Design Foundations, in 2000 and it was published in 2002. The tenth edition was just published in 2020! The first edition of my second web development textbook, Basics of Web Design, was published in 2015.

This causes the browser to skip the nav class when applying the style sheet. This technique can be useful in testing when you are experimenting with a number of properties. Similar to the temporary background colors, you could temporarily configure an element with a 3 pixel red solid border—this will really jump out at you and help you recognize the issue sooner.

B HTML5 Global Attributes

Web designers use screen captures, also called screen shots, in print media and online to show the contents of a computer screen at a point in time. Technical blogs, webpage software tutorials, and technical support webpages often use screen shots. Most screen capture software and apps also contain features for editing the images. You learn more about images created using illustration software and apps in the next section.

Restrict responses to characters or numbers or both as appropriate. • Use check boxes to allow users to submit more than one response to a query. What should I consider when modifying GIF colors? When possible, decrease the bit depth or number of colors of images. Instead of 8-bit/256 colors, experiment to see if 6-bit/64 colors or 4-bit/16 colors yields satisfactory images. To learn more, use a search engine to search for GIF color bits.

I have PDF need to convert into DES format so I can use on quickbooks. VideoNotes are designed to teach students key programming concepts and techniques with short, step-by-step videos that demonstrate how to solve problems by coding. FAQs cover questions frequently asked of the author by her students, are included in the book, and marked with an FAQ icon. Focus on web design through an additional activity that explores web design topics touched on in the chapter to reinforce, enhance, and extend course topics.

Other sites sell the data to outside companies. Web sites can and do change their privacy policies over time. Consumers may be leery of purchasing online because of the potential lack of privacy. Major functions of e-commerce include the buying of goods, the selling of goods, and the performance of financial transactions on the Internet.

Streaming audio begins playing as the server delivers the audio file to the computer or device. Visitors must have a plug-in or app installed, such as Xbox Music (Figure 6-9) or Apple QuickTime Player®, to listen to audio. To stream audio, your webpage files must be stored on a server that also has streaming software to deliver the audio stream when requested by the browser. Figure 6-10 lists common audio file formats. Gadgets Chapter 3 introduced you to gadgets, also called widgets.

You can read an excerpt at A List Apart magazine, or buy it directly from the publisher in a beautiful paperback edition, as a set of DRM-free eBook files, or both. The web was born in a particle physics laboratory in Geneva, Switzerland, in 1989. There a computer specialist named Tim Berners-Lee first proposed a system of information management that used a “hypertext” process to link related documents over a network. He and his partner, Robert Cailliau, created a prototype and released it for review. For the first several years, web pages were text-only.

Notice how the text labels for the form controls are on the left side of the content area but are right-aligned. Create a class called labelCol that will float to the left, has a width of 100 pixels, aligns text to the right, and has 10 pixels of padding on the right. Tags, increase the readability and usability of the Web form for all visitors. Be sure to include contact information (e-mail address and/or phone number) just in case a visitor is unable to submit your form successfully and requires additional assistance.

Use your research to make a ­recommendation based on price, services offered, and other significant program features. The Webby Awards and industry organizations such as the Web Marketing Association also recognize exemplary websites. If you decide to compete for an award, ensure that the award is relevant to your website’s content and objectives. Many award websites recognize characteristics related to design, creativity, usability, and functionality.

After creating your website, you should continually gather feedback from your target audience to update your target audience profile and fine-tune the website’s content. 2 UX Research UX guidelines and techniques for enhancing website users’ experience. Find at least one web design blog entry that discusses UX.

Compare your work with the sample found in the student files (Chapter7/favorites.html). Don’t worry if the use of “../” notation and linking to files in different folders seems new and different. In most of the exercises in this book you will code either absolute links to other Web sites or relative links to files in the same folder. Since the page now uses a gradient background image, remove the background-color style rule from this class.

Use both only to further the website’s message and purpose and enrich the target audience’s experience at the website. Permission from your instructor if using a school-owned computer or device.) 3. Name the source of the animated GIF you chose and describe it.

Working in harmony with TCP, IP is a set of rules that controls how data are sent between computers on the Internet. IP routes a packet to the correct destination address. Once sent, the packet gets successively forwarded to the next closest router until it reaches its destination. How does information get transferred from the web server to the web browser?

A text link should clearly identify its target, which is the webpage or content to which the link points. Avoid using ambiguous text, such as click here, to indicate a text link. When including text links to related content, such as an article that provides background information, create the text link using existing text that flows within the page content. This technique frequently is used in news articles, such as the one in the PCWorld article shown in Figure 4-3 on the following page.

  • As this book introduces web development and design techniques, corresponding web accessibility and usability issues are discussed.
  • Professional photographers use digital cameras with higher megapixel capabilities to produce larger quality images, such as poster-sized.
  • Creating a blog using one of these tools can be as simple as entering an email address and password, selecting a layout template for your blog, and specifying where to host the blog.

There are advantages to using an animated GIF to add action to your Web page. This format is widely supported, does not require a browser plug-in, and is relatively easy to create. When you decide to add an animated GIF to your Web page, try to use the image for special emphasis only. If you’re like most people, at some time you have been annoyed by a flashing ad banner at the top of a Web page.

With web pages Make your pages display well on mobile devices by creating a responsive web design … Similar to theTrip Generation Manual, Parking Generation Manualis available in hard-copy, electronic, and web-based formats in order to cater to the format that works best for users. The web-based app allows a user to produce parking generation data plots and statistics for the complete database as well as filtering by year and location. Do you want to build web pages but have no prior experience?

Describe how to optimize your images to create web-ready images; discuss four ways to help ensure your images are web-ready. CompuServe created the Graphics Interchange Format bitmap image file format in the late 1980s. The GIF image file format was the original image format used on the web. GIFs contain a compression algorithm that reduces file size. GIF images are 8-bit color images, meaning they have a maximum of 256 colors. This color l­imitation makes the GIF format inappropriate for complex images, such as photographs.

It can be conducted at any phase of a Web site’s development and is often performed more than once. A usability test is conducted by asking users to complete tasks on a Web site, such as placing an order, looking up the phone number of a company, or finding a product. The exact tasks will vary depending on the Web site being tested.

Notice that the tag is placed before the script block and the tag is placed after the script block. This renders the userName in the heading format. There is also a single space after the “o” in “Hello”. If you miss this space, you’ll see the userName value displayed right after the “o”.

2 Security Issues Search the Internet for articles that deal with security issues surrounding rich media ads and other online ads. Find recommendations for your browser settings. Check the settings in your browser. Summarize what you have learned about security concerns and recommendations. List the steps you took, if any, to protect yourself. A measure of the number of times an online ad is viewed.

The sheet is printed in PDF format. The pages are already customized in the template. We have a team of passionate application developers specialised in developing games, app, CRM ,ERP , Blockchain, Crypto , NFts and websites. With the release of HTML5 and browsers that constantly update, HTML is experiencing a renaissance. CSS3 and the recent upgrades to JavaScript have also helped change the way we build striking and useful sites today.

The id attribute creates an identifier that can be used by the and anchor tags. It triggers the action method on the tag and causes the browser to send the form data to the Web server. The Web server will invoke the server-side processing program or script listed on the form’s action property.

In the early days, we just made do with tools originally designed for print. Today, there are wonderful tools created specifically with web design in mind that make the process more efficient. The idea is to agree upon a visual language for the site before production begins.

Security experts recommend when using a public Wi-Fi network that you avoid accessing personal information, such as financial transactions. If you have a Wi-Fi network in your home or business, use passwords and encryption to avoid unauthorized and potentially damaging access by others. For more information, use a search engine to search for Wi-Fi safety tips. Include methods to share your website’s content by providing links to send ­content using email, or post to the user’s Facebook page, RSS feed, or account on Pinterest or Twitter.

The next section introduces the CSS class and id selectors, which are widely utilized to configure specific page elements. Look carefully at the browser window. The tag is also used when viewers bookmark your page or add it to their Favorites. An engaging and descriptive page title may entice a visitor to revisit your page. If your Web page is for a company or an organization, it’s a good idea to include the name of the company or organization in the title.

Internal links are used for this function. You need to adjust the starting location of the footer id. The area assigned to the footer id now includes the text navigation, copyright information, and e-mail link. Replace the closing div tag between the text navigation and the copyright information with a line break tag. Save your page in the wildflowers folder and test it in a browser.

Figures are provided both with and without callouts. • POWERPOINT PRESENTATIONS A one-click-per-slide presentation system provides PowerPoint slides for every subject in each chapter. Presentations are based on chapter objectives. 12.7 Order and Payment Processing In B2C e-commerce, the products for sale are displayed in an online catalog. On large sites, these catalog pages are dynamically created using server-side scripts to access databases.

Only include them on a website to add value, further the website’s message and purpose, and meet the target audience’s expectation for content. Effective uses of animation can include catching a visitor’s attention, demonstrating a simple process, or illustrating change over time, such as the metamorphosis of a butterfly. Animated GIFs are the most popular, widely used form of animation on the web. You can use software and apps specially designed for creating web graphics to create animated GIFs. RIAs are interactive multimedia animations and movies that entertain and inform visitors.

Some material in this chapter may be a review from your life experience or earlier studies. This web site contains links to other sites. Please be aware that we are not responsible for the privacy practices of such other sites. We encourage our users to be aware when they leave our site and to read the privacy statements of each and every web site that collects Personal Information. This privacy statement applies solely to information collected by this web site.

Jennifer Robbins began designing for the web in 1993 as the graphic designer for Global Network Navigator, the first commercial website. In addition to this book, she has written multiple editions of Web Design in a Nutshell andHTML5 Pocket Reference, published by O’Reilly. She is a founder and orga-nizer of the Artifact Conference, which addresses issues related to mobile web design. Jennifer has spoken at many conferences and has taught beginning web design at Johnson and Wales University in Providence, Rhode Island. When not on the clock, Jennifer enjoys making things, indie rock, cooking, travel, and raising a cool kid.